excel里的函数怎么复制

excel里的函数怎么复制

复制Excel中的函数包括:复制单元格、使用填充柄、使用快捷键、复制和粘贴特殊功能。 其中,使用填充柄是最常用的一种方法,它不仅可以高效地复制函数,还能自动调整引用范围。下面将详细介绍这些方法和技巧。

一、复制单元格

复制单元格是最基本的操作,也是最直观的。你只需要选择包含函数的单元格,按下Ctrl+C复制,然后选择目标单元格,按下Ctrl+V粘贴即可。这种方法适用于单个或少量单元格的复制。

操作步骤:

  1. 选择包含函数的单元格。
  2. 按下Ctrl+C进行复制。
  3. 选择目标单元格。
  4. 按下Ctrl+V进行粘贴。

这种方法的优点是简单直观,缺点是当需要复制大量单元格时,效率较低。

二、使用填充柄

填充柄是Excel中一个非常实用的工具,位于选中单元格的右下角。当光标变成一个黑色的十字时,拖动填充柄可以快速复制函数到相邻单元格,并自动调整引用范围。

操作步骤:

  1. 选择包含函数的单元格。
  2. 将光标移动到单元格右下角,直到变成黑色十字。
  3. 按住左键,向下或向右拖动到目标范围。
  4. 松开鼠标,函数将自动复制并调整引用。

示例:

假设在A1单元格中有一个函数=B1+C1,你可以使用填充柄将这个函数复制到A2、A3等单元格中,Excel会自动调整引用为=B2+C2=B3+C3

三、使用快捷键

Excel提供了一些快捷键,可以快速复制和粘贴函数。例如,使用Ctrl+D和Ctrl+R分别向下和向右填充函数。这些快捷键可以提高操作效率,尤其是在处理大量数据时。

操作步骤:

  1. 选择包含函数的单元格。
  2. 按下Ctrl+D将函数向下复制,或Ctrl+R将函数向右复制。

示例:

假设在A1单元格中有一个函数=B1+C1,选择A1和A2单元格,按下Ctrl+D,函数将复制到A2单元格,并自动调整为=B2+C2

四、复制和粘贴特殊功能

Excel的“粘贴特殊”功能提供了更多的选项,可以选择性地复制函数、格式、值等。这在某些情况下非常有用,例如,当你只想复制函数而不改变目标单元格的格式时。

操作步骤:

  1. 选择包含函数的单元格。
  2. 按下Ctrl+C进行复制。
  3. 选择目标单元格。
  4. 右键点击,选择“粘贴特殊”。
  5. 在弹出的对话框中选择“公式”。
  6. 点击“确定”。

这种方法的优点是可以选择性地复制内容,灵活性较高。

五、使用命名范围

命名范围是Excel中的一个高级功能,它可以为一个或多个单元格定义一个名称,方便在函数中引用。通过命名范围,你可以更方便地复制和管理函数。

操作步骤:

  1. 选择要命名的单元格或范围。
  2. 在公式栏左侧的名称框中输入名称,按下Enter。
  3. 在函数中使用这个名称。

示例:

假设将B1:C1命名为DataRange,在A1单元格中输入函数=SUM(DataRange)。复制A1单元格到其他单元格时,引用将保持不变,非常适合处理复杂的数据集。

六、使用数组公式

数组公式是一种特殊的公式,可以一次性处理多个值。使用数组公式可以在一个单元格中完成多个计算,并将结果复制到其他单元格。

操作步骤:

  1. 输入数组公式,并按下Ctrl+Shift+Enter。
  2. 选择包含数组公式的单元格。
  3. 按下Ctrl+C进行复制。
  4. 选择目标单元格,按下Ctrl+V进行粘贴。

示例:

在A1:A3单元格中输入数据,选择B1单元格,输入数组公式=A1:A3*2,按下Ctrl+Shift+Enter。复制B1单元格到其他单元格,数组公式将自动应用。

七、使用VBA宏

对于高级用户,VBA宏提供了极大的灵活性和自动化能力。你可以编写VBA代码来复制和粘贴函数,处理复杂的数据任务。

操作步骤:

  1. 按下Alt+F11打开VBA编辑器。
  2. 插入一个新模块,编写VBA代码。
  3. 运行宏,自动复制函数。

示例:

Sub CopyFunction()

Range("A1").Copy Destination:=Range("A2:A10")

End Sub

这个宏将复制A1单元格的函数到A2:A10单元格,非常适合处理大批量的数据任务。

八、注意事项

在复制函数时,需要注意以下几点:

  1. 引用类型:了解相对引用和绝对引用的区别,确保函数在复制后仍然正确。
  2. 格式:确保目标单元格的格式与源单元格一致,避免数据错误。
  3. 数据范围:确保复制范围内的数据完整,避免遗漏或重复。

通过上述方法和技巧,你可以高效地复制Excel中的函数,提高工作效率。无论是简单的单元格复制,还是复杂的VBA宏,都能满足不同场景的需求。

相关问答FAQs:

1. 如何在Excel中复制函数?
在Excel中复制函数非常简单。首先,选择包含函数的单元格。然后,将鼠标悬停在选择的单元格的右下角,直到光标变成一个加号。接下来,按住鼠标左键并拖动光标到您想要复制函数的单元格范围。松开鼠标左键后,Excel会自动复制函数到所选单元格范围内。

2. 如何在Excel中复制函数但保留引用?
如果您想在Excel中复制函数但保留引用,可以使用绝对引用。在选择包含函数的单元格后,按下F4键,或者手动添加$符号来锁定某个单元格的引用。然后按照上述步骤复制函数,Excel会自动复制函数并保留相对引用和绝对引用。

3. 如何在Excel中复制函数并自动调整引用?
在Excel中,复制函数并自动调整引用非常方便。选择包含函数的单元格,然后按住Ctrl键,再拖动选择的单元格范围。在松开Ctrl键后,Excel会自动复制函数并根据目标单元格调整引用。这样,您可以快速在不同的单元格范围中应用相同的函数,而不需要手动调整引用。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4664366

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部